“Of Light and Air: Winslow Homer in Watercolor” brings dozens of the artist’s watercolors in the collection back into the galleries for the first time in nearly half a century. A new generation of visitors can now enjoy these works alongside a selection of Homer’s oils, drawings, and prints.

With material ranging from Homer’s childhood to his final canvas, left unfinished at the time of his death, the exhibition follows the major chapters in Homer’s career and offers insight into the various environments—ecological, artistic, social, and economic—that shaped his enduring work in watercolor.

Christina Michelon, Pamela and Peter Voss Curator of Prints and Drawings, invites you to this virtual lecture to celebrate the artist’s mastery of the medium and the innovative techniques he pioneered.
